HD RANGER 2 LTE interference
LTE interference on SMATV systems
Minimizing LTE effect on your TV system
The HD RANGER 2 has a variety of tools that allow you to compare the signal reception
quality measurements on digital TV channels with and without the LTE filter. This is very helpful to
anticipate the performance improvement you should expect on your TV distribution system well
before you physically make changes to the cabling to insert the LTE filter.
LTE interference on CATV networks
Locating interference sources to prevent service calls
Some of the bands allocated to LTE are near or inside former
television bands. For example band 5 (uplink 824-849 MHz;
downlink 869-894 MHz). The HD RANGER 2 has special
functions to help installers determine the level of activity in those
bands and therefore anticipate potential interference problems.
Downlink and Uplink interference
Visualizing the two different scenarios
Downlink interference comes from the mobile phone base stations
which are placed at fixed locations and are always on. This is not the
case of Uplink interference which comes from the handheld devices
and therefore it can be a lot more difficult to locate and mitigate.
